Church View has been renovated (in 2022) with comfort and cosiness in mind. This property is deceptively spacious providing accommodation across three floors. This holiday home provides accommodation for up to seven guests, choose from two double bedrooms one twin room and one single bedroom. Ideally situated in the picturesque market town of Skipton, known as the ‘Gateway to the Dales’, with rolling countryside views for miles around! Local walks that will be sure to knock your socks off and so many local attractions to keep you busy and create ever lasting memories on your holiday. The town boasts a range of traditional shops, restaurants and bars and a canal. The property is within a stone’s throw away from local shops and the town centre.

Skipton

This cottage is located in Skipton. Craven Museum and Gallery and The Mart Theatre are cultural highlights, and some of the area's landmarks include Skipton Castle and Bolton Priory. Hesketh Farm Park and Thornton Hall Farm Country Park are also worth visiting.
